how to tell the discriminant of a graph of an quadratic eqation

Respuesta :

MrsMurdock
MrsMurdock MrsMurdock
  • 03-04-2020

Answer:

to find the value of the discriminant of a quadratic equation you can use the formula --> discriminant = b^2 - 4ac

use ax^2 + bx + c to find the correct values
